New to the collection

The Library has been busier than ever in 2020, adding to its collection of more than six million items. See some of these amazing new additions on display for the first time. 

This exhibition features over 20 newly acquired items, including a visual diary by 99 year-old artist Guy Warren recording his time in lockdown in Sydney, the first printed star chart of the Southern Hemisphere (1515) and one of the earliest books of modern zoology (1551-58).
